I guess I should be lucky that I ordered mine Feb 2 then. From what I have been told or not told, I most likely will see mine in Nov. I know it will be the 09 model I got my email for the configuration the day after they put out the new specs on the 09. When I configured it, they had the new RALLY RED, which I picked. I also noticed when I printed it out, that it has the gas cap sensor that is new, and the cargo side door compartments. So, I am guessing, that you configured your car before the 09 specs got uploaded to the smart site for configuration. If you still have your link/ printout, you would just have to look for the new cargo net, or gas cap, and you would be getting the 09.
